Cost Analysis and Return on Investment for Blended Learning

  • Santosh Panda

摘要

This chapter first introduces some conceptual clarity on various economic terms, especially on costing, cost-effectiveness and cost-efficiency, followed by costing of open and distance learning (ODL) and online learning, and especially blended learning. While we get mixed results for cost-effectiveness and efficiency in the case of blended learning, some of the concerns including return-on-investment (ROI) and return-on-expectations have been discussed. It may be underlined that effectiveness and efficiency of blended learning depends on the type of blending that the institution adopts, faculty and student expertise, and faculty and student involvement. Though efficiency remains as the major institutional concern, most studies have shown that it is effectiveness and quality addition to learning that matters. The future research and evaluation studies on costs of blended learning need to take care of the standardization of the costing approach and cost-effectiveness/efficiency in relation to student satisfaction and learning outcomes in both the limited classroom and the wider distance online learning and blended learning contexts.
